Meet Andreco Bowles of The Sole Connect

Today we’d like to introduce you to Andreco Bowles.

Andreco, let’s start with your story. We’d love to hear how you got started and how the journey has been so far.
I started out collecting sneakers. Growing up I didn’t have all of the new sneakers that everyone else had. As a kid that bothered me but I knew my mom did what she could so I never complained. Once I was old enough to work and make my own money, I told myself that I would buy every sneaker that I wanted whenever it released. Time went on and my collection began to grow. I started to create a bond with a lot of employees in the shoe stores because I was there shopping frequently. Over time I began to get the shoes most of my friends weren’t able to get their hands on. That lead to them asking me for assistance in getting their own pair of the hottest new releases. Of course, I wanted to help my friends out so I would ask the employees I’m the store if they could help me out and they agreed. Eventually my friends would start to offer me money for helping them. To be fair I would split the money with the employee who could help me out in the store. As a result of this my friends would tell others to reach out to me to help them get sneakers if they weren’t able to successfully get a pair for themselves. It turned into a bidding war where people would offer more and more money to get me to help them get a pair of exclusive sneakers. This inspired me to come up with the name “The Sole Connect” since I was connecting so many people with the products that they desired.

Overall, has it been relatively smooth? If not, what were some of the struggles along the way?
It has been a very long road, however, without struggle there is no progress. It took a while for the word of mouth to spread for me to get a lot of business at first. Due to my limited resources and my small network I wasn’t always able to get every shoe for everyone that asked. Traveling was an issue for me at one point as well. There are some sneakers that only release in specific cities. If you aren’t able to travel then it’s virtually impossible to purchase them. I’ve had packages that were being shipped become lost or stolen. On several occasions I would come home from work to see someone attempted to break into my apartment. My cars broken into at malls or at night at my residence. There have been a number of things to happen that made me want to stop selling sneakers.

Alright – so let’s talk business. Tell us about The Sole Connect – what should we know?
The Sole Connect is a company that helps consumers have access to the sneakers that they want but aren’t so fortunate to find. Especially with the pandemic going on today. Stores being closed or companies having late shipments. There are so many factors that prevent people from being able to get the sneakers that they have been waiting weeks, months or all year to purchase. We specialize in providing convenience as well as peace of mind with pre orders for sneakers on upcoming releases. Pre orders are available at least 2 weeks before the sneaker release and are 100% guaranteed. We will secure the sneakers in the specific size you ask for and bring you the shoes so that you don’t have to leave the comfort of your home. We can also meet you while you’re out running errands so you can complete other tasks instead of waiting in long lines at sneaker stores. We also ship domestically so you can pre order with us even if you live in another state.
